Thiophene based polyazomethines as a prototype of organic polymeric superlattices
Destri S;Porzio W;
1997
Abstract
A series of regularly alternating copolymers, constituted by thienylenic segments (low Eg) and phenylenic sequences (high Eg) linked together by azomethines groups, were prepared and characterized molecularly and spectroscopically.
